WebbWhen you set a price, it must be higher than the variable cost of producing your product or service. Each sale will then make a contribution towards covering your fixed costs - and making profits. Webb25 jan. 2024 · Product bundling is a strategy in retail that involves creating and selling a curated collection of complementary products that can help you capture both casual browsers and eager-to-buy shoppers. Sometimes products are bundled together as an upsell or a cross-sell. Upsells involve persuading the customer to upgrade.
